Ideas on a 72-68 loss to UCLA:
Indiana had the 2-3 zone rocking once more. Mackenzie Mgbako was getting buckets early, too.
However as the primary half rolled alongside, UCLA’s elite protection began to place the clamps down. After a Mgbako bucket on the 16:16 mark, Indiana didn’t make one other basket till Oumar Ballo put one house with 8:34 to go, a field-goal drought of seven:42. And in contrast to Michigan State, the Bruins weren’t as stymied by Indiana’s zone. The Hoosiers didn’t keep it up, returning to man-to-man protection for a lot, although not all of, the remainder of the competition.
Aday Mara, all 7-foot-3 of him, was a one-man spotlight reel in his eight minutes of first-half motion. Mara made his presence felt on either side of the ball, scoring six factors, blocking two pictures and doling out a pleasant help on a Trent Perry bucket.
Indiana’s offense continued to wrestle and the first-half numbers weren’t fairly. The Hoosiers scored simply 25 factors on .84 factors per possession. Because the Bruins confirmed extra stress and double-teaming on Ballo and Malik Reneau, the Hoosiers couldn’t capitalize on the 3-point seems to be they discovered of it. Indiana completed the primary half simply 2-of-13 (15.4 %) from deep and trailed by 10 at half (35-25).
IU turned it up within the second half. The rebounding was higher. Luke Goode heated up (14 second-half factors on 5-of-7 capturing) as he scored in any respect three ranges. However each time the Hoosiers threatened to get inside a possession, UCLA had a solution. Indiana labored it to a four-point deficit on 5 events within the second half earlier than the ultimate minute of motion. Every time, the Bruins scored factors to fend off IU’s comebacks.
It appeared like UCLA would stroll away with this one as Sebastian Mack grabbed a rebound off a Goode missed 3-pointer with 1:18 to go and the Bruins up seven (70-63). However as Anthony Leal fouled Mack, Mack tossed an elbow into his face. Upon evaluation, Mack was charged with a technical foul and Leal a typical foul. Mack missed the entrance finish of his 1-and-1. Goode sunk each free throws for Indiana and the Hoosiers received the ball.
Myles Rice took an ill-advised lengthy 2 on that possession. Goode then needed to foul Dylan Andrews to attempt to lengthen the sport. Andrews missed the entrance finish of a 1-and-1 and Mgbako discovered Reneau for a bucket on IU’s ensuing possession. Reneau was fouled and made the free throw for a 3-point play, the Hoosiers lastly getting it inside a possession at 70-68 with 53 seconds to play. Mack missed a driving lay-up on the opposite finish and Rice and Leal have been capable of tie up Skyy Clark on the rebound with the possession arrow favoring Indiana.
Rice took one other questionable shot, a mid-range one off the appropriate baseline that missed for Indiana. Mgbako had a point-blank putback on Rice’s miss that didn’t drop, however IU retained possession because the ball went out of bounds off UCLA.
Out of the baseline out-of-bounds play, Mgbako labored to get open within the left nook for a 3-pointer, getting one other nice look on a go-ahead shot. But it surely, like his putback, simply couldn’t discover the web. UCLA grabbed the rebound, and this time, Andrews hit each of the free throws to present UCLA the victory at 72-68.
“I want I had the reply,” Mike Woodson mentioned after the sport on Indiana’s shut losses this season. “I am going again to the Northwestern recreation. The Maryland recreation. The Purdue recreation. The Michigan recreation. They’re all winnable video games.”
Tonight’s loss is Indiana’s fourth straight at house. It was one other shot at a Quad 1 win that the Hoosiers couldn’t end. One other one presents itself subsequent weekend towards Purdue.
However time is operating out on the season. If Indiana can’t string some wins collectively quickly, it’ll be curtains on its possibilities to make the Large Dance.
